Penerapan Algoritma Greedy Pada Mesin Penjual Otomatis (Vending Machine)

Alamsyah -, Indriani Tiara Putri

Abstract


Dalam memasarkan produk minuman dan makanan ringan, Indonesia masih banyak menggunakan tenaga manusia untuk menyalurkan produk tersebut dari pabrik sampai ke konsumen akhir. Jika setiap toko membeli produk dalam jumlah banyak, maka didapatkan keuntungan yang besar dalam penjualan produk tersebut. Hal ini menyebabkan harga penjualan produk yang sampai ke konsumen akhir lebih mahal daripada harga asli yang diberikan oleh pabrik. Dengan permasalahan tersebut, penulis mencoba membuat aplikasi mesin penjual otomatis (vending machine). Pada umumnya vending machine tidak memberikan uang kembalian. Disini penulis mencoba membuat vending machine dengan menerapkan algoritma Greedy agar dapat memberikan uang kembalian sehingga harga penjualan produk sesuai dengan harga asli pabrik. Algoritma Greedy diterapkan untuk menentukan pecahan berapa saja yang muncul dalam proses pengembalian uang dengan meminimalkan jumlah uang logamnya. Penulis menggunakan aplikasi Visual Basic untuk menerapkan program vending machine.


Keywords


Vending machine, Algoritma greedy, Visual basic

Full Text:

PDF

References


Pradeepa, P, dkk. 2013. Design and Implementation of Vending Machine Using Verilog HDL. International Journal of Advanced Engineering Technology: 51.

Rentika, Rika, dkk. 2014. Teknik Pemodelan dan Simulasi Vending Machine. Makalah USU: 9 & 11.

Nugroho, Aryo. 2010. Penggunakan Algoritma Greedy dalam Aplikasi Vending Machine. Jurnal STEI ITB: 14.




DOI: https://doi.org/10.15294/sji.v1i2.4608

Refbacks

  • There are currently no refbacks.




Creative Commons License
This work is licensed under a Creative Commons Attribution 4.0 International License.